However I agree that the signoff process needs to be relaxed a little.
I'm very new here and I've seen devs reworking on an already fixed bug
because it doesn't apply anymore, because nobody signed-it-off on time.

Currently it's hard for some developers to signoff something they don't
care about. Trivial stuff, ok, but what if you need a more complicated
setup than usual?

We can use other ideas in conjunction as well, like having assigned
people to sign off each area.

I'll contribute one another: to have sign-off fests every now and then.
Maybe once/twice a month?
